Ceiling Joist Repair in Kansas City, KS
Ceiling joist repair services address issues related to the structural beams that support the weight of ceilings and floors within a property. These repairs typically involve fixing or replacing damaged or weakened joists caused by factors such as moisture damage, wood rot, pests, or age-related wear. Projects can include restoring the integrity of ceiling framing in living rooms, basements, attics, or other areas where the ceiling structure has been compromised, ensuring safety and stability for the entire property.
Property owners interested in ceiling joist repair should understand the importance of assessing the extent of damage before requesting service. Common signs indicating a need for repair include sagging ceilings, cracks, or unusual creaking sounds. It is also helpful to know whether the damage is localized or widespread, as this can influence the scope of work. Proper evaluation ensures that repairs restore the ceiling’s structural integrity and prevent further issues, providing peace of mind for homeowners and property owners alike.

Ceiling Joist Repair Questions
What are ceiling joists? Ceiling joists are horizontal supports that help hold up the ceiling and roof structure in a building.
How can I tell if my ceiling joists need repair? Signs include sagging ceilings, cracks in drywall, or unusual creaking sounds in the attic area.
What causes ceiling joists to become damaged? Damage can result from moisture issues, pest infestations, or structural shifts over time.
What are common repair options for damaged ceiling joists? Repairs often involve replacing or reinforcing the affected joists to restore stability and safety.
